D Djawari is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Rheumatology and Dermatology. According to data from OpenAlex, D Djawari has authored 43 papers receiving a total of 415 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Epidemiology, 13 papers in Rheumatology and 11 papers in Dermatology. Recurrent topics in D Djawari’s work include Ocular Diseases and Behçet’s Syndrome (7 papers), Relapsing Polychondritis and VEXAS Syndrome Research (6 papers) and Immunodeficiency and Autoimmune Disorders (5 papers). D Djawari is often cited by papers focused on Ocular Diseases and Behçet’s Syndrome (7 papers), Relapsing Polychondritis and VEXAS Syndrome Research (6 papers) and Immunodeficiency and Autoimmune Disorders (5 papers). D Djawari coll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Italy and Austria. D Djawari's co-authors include O. P. Hornstein, W Keitel, Christos C. Zouboulis, Klaus Fritz, Thomas Licht, Harald Gollnick, Rudolf Stadler, Ina Kötter, Erhard Hölzle and Wilhelm Kirch and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Academy of Dermatology, British Journal of Dermatology and Acta Dermato Venereologica.
